fx3u-232adp程序

fx3u 在 JavaScript 中,异常处理主要通过以下模式实现: javascript try {// 您的代码 } catch (error) {// 异常处理 } finally {// 无论是否发生异常都会执行的代码块 }其中:try 块包含您希望监控异常的代码。catch 块在发生异常时执行,用于捕获并处理异常对象。finally 块在 try 或 catch 块执行后始终执行,无论是否发生异常。创建异常在 JavaScript中,可以使用 `throw` 语句手动创建异常对象: javascript throw new Error('自定义异常消息');捕获异常使用 catch 块可以捕获异常对象: javascript try {// 您的代码 } catch (error) {console.log(error.message); }在此示例中,error 变量包含异常对象,其中包含有关异常的详细信息,例如错误消息。处理异常在 catch 块中,您可以使用异常对象的信息来处理异常:记录错误消息通知用户重试操作终止程序处理异常的最佳方式取决于异常的类型和您的应用程序的特定需求。finally 块finally 块在 try 或 catch 块执行后始终执行。它通常用于释放资源或执行其他清理任务: javascript try {// 您的代码 } catch (error) {// 异常处理 } finally {// 释放资源 }优点使用异常处理的主要优点包括:代码稳定性:防止程序因未预料的异常而崩溃。调试简易性:提供了一个明确的位置来处理和调试异常。灵活性:允许您根据异常类型定制错误处理。用户友好性:提供优雅的机制来处理错误,从而为用户提供更好的体验。最佳实践使用异常处理时遵循以下最佳实践至关重要:仅捕获已知的异常:不要捕获未知的异常,因为这可能会掩盖潜在的问题。提供有意义的错误消息:异常消息应该清晰、简明,以便用户或开发人员可以轻松理解错误的性质。使用适当的异常类型:根据异常的性质使用特定的异常类型,例如 `TypeError` 或 `SyntaxError`。记录异常:将异常信息记录到日志文件中,以供以后分析和调试。定期测试异常处理:通过注入异常来测试您的异常处理代码,以确保其在所有情况下都能正常工作。结论异常处理是编写稳定、可靠代码的重要组成部分。通过理解异常处理模式并遵守最佳实践,您可以有效地管理代码中的异常情况,从而提高应用程序的质量和用户体验。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论